Uruguay weighs Arrascaeta's return for World Cup group match vs Spain

Flamengo midfielder Giorgian De Arrascaeta is training with the Uruguay national team but remains a doubt for the upcoming World Cup games because of a right‑calf injury sustained in pre‑tournament preparations. Uruguay coach Marcelo Bielsa said his inclusion will depend on the team's progress and whether the player is fit for the third group‑stage match against Spain, scheduled for 26 June. Arrascaeta did not feature in Uruguay's opening win over Saudi Arabia and is expected to be rested for the earlier fixture against Cape Verde in Miami.

The Uruguay federation’s medical staff continues to monitor his recovery, while Flamengo watches closely, concerned about the player's workload after recent shoulder surgery. If cleared, Arrascaeta could provide a creative spark for Uruguay in the decisive group match.
